Output 8f33ee433000f5499db811a2a89828c3ac00091d7e92b03b1556a5861397b148:1

value
10519829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ef38fad5d9e0ffc100eed8bbcb810369e5da664d OP_EQUAL
address
3PVugRFUmYqjKs3uNfo9fUHwshcuSSgZpA
transaction
8f33ee433000f5499db811a2a89828c3ac00091d7e92b03b1556a5861397b148
confirmations
134605
spent
true